# HG changeset patch # User Richard Stallman # Date 1031281733 0 # Node ID 9f0064f1b6d83e43a384cd576d8618ec24cdb5fb # Parent b553adc493389f4cd3eebe237184543928998136 (set_image_of_range_1): In no-TRANSLATE case, call EXTEND_RANGE_TABLE and return a proper value. (set_image_of_range): Don't call set_image_of_range_1 if no TRANSLATE or if range includes all of Latin-1. Only call it for the Latin-1 part of the range. For other cases, make two separate ranges, one for the original specified characters and one for their case-conversions. diff --git a/regex.c b/regex.c --- a/regex.c +++ b/regex.c @@ -2145,9 +2145,10 @@ if (!RE_TRANSLATE_P (translate)) { + EXTEND_RANGE_TABLE (work_area, 2); work_area->table[work_area->used++] = (start); work_area->table[work_area->used++] = (end); - return; + return -1; } eqv_table = XCHAR_TABLE (translate)->extras[2]; @@ -2253,12 +2254,14 @@ #endif /* emacs */ -/* We need to find the image of the range start..end when passed through +/* Record the the image of the range start..end when passed through TRANSLATE.
